Subject: DR drill — InvoiceForge renderer, Thursday

Welcome aboard. Thursday's drill simulates total loss of the InvoiceForge PDF rendering cluster in the Dunmere region. Your role: restore the renderer from the cold snapshot, verify font embedding, and confirm a test invoice renders identically to the golden copy. You'll need access to the sealed restore account, which stays dormant outside drills. Do not reset it; doing so invalidates the escrow. The account's recovery passphrase is recorded below.

vault phrase of kajop-kaweg = sorix-istys-noviel

**14:22 — Transcode farm backlog spikes**

Okay, here's where it got messy. The Fernwheel transcoding farm started rejecting new jobs because a bad config push capped worker concurrency at 2 instead of 32. Queue depth ballooned to about 9,000 jobs in twenty minutes, and retries made it worse. Heads up for contractors: the dashboard showed workers as healthy the whole time, which is why nobody noticed immediately. We traced the bad config to a specific build, noted below.

trace token, fafog-kageg: htk4_98e6

**Leadership Review Briefing — Sales Leads**

We are recommending closure of the Fenwick Hollow office at the end of Q2. The site serves eleven staff, all of whom can transfer to the Aldercross hub or move to remote arrangements. Lease termination costs are modest and fully offset within a year by reduced overhead. Client coverage in the region remains unchanged; Priya Alden will coordinate handovers. Please treat the attached note with appropriate care.

confidential, kagup-bafog: Fraaxax Group is in early talks to buy Soroxox Group for about $343.8 million. The Olidor launch date is June 14, and nothing goes to the press before then. Legal wants the Aldmirek Logistics term sheet signed before July 23.

**Q: My badge doesn't work since the system migration — what do I do?**

A: During the move from the old Trellick readers to the new Passerine system, some badges need re-enrolment. Visit the Level 1 security desk at Osbourne Works with photo ID and your starter letter. Until your badge is re-enrolled, enter through the north door using the interim code below.

turnstile pass: bdg-YPPQB-52010